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
381 011927068 120790702
176118 99360879
176118 99360879
27702553 183021401 95
All about undefined
Interested in learning more?
176118 99360879
27702553 183021401 95
See more
934069301 9846 3429464798
22084 5696 882109 55820 7885
See more
9954 03291723
2557 72 61 44660937593
See more